Output d3eaf802daa60ded73c22ca841b613203904fb229952867c654072af68170a30:0

value
1051121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b1e351d6b926f2094ff7ca328d0fbb11a5bc2f OP_EQUAL
address
3CEkjUcc3dkvjqpHEuij8nTY6bP5SmDXmb
transaction
d3eaf802daa60ded73c22ca841b613203904fb229952867c654072af68170a30
spent
true